NM1: Philippe Hervé to Depart LyonSO at Season's End
Renowned coach Philippe Hervé, who has previously led prestigious French basketball teams such as Chalon, ASVEL, Orléans, Limoges, and Cholet, is set to leave LyonSO at the conclusion of the current season. His team, presently holding the 5th position in Pool B of Nationale 1 with a record of 18 wins and 10 losses, has 8 more games remaining under his guidance.
